What Are Mobility Scooters?
Mobility scooters are motorized automobiles designed to assist people with mobility concerns. They can be found in different sizes and designs, from compact models ideal for indoor usage to bigger, more robust designs for outdoor experiences. These scooters are geared up with comfortable seating, handlebars for steering, and a battery-powered motor that moves the automobile forward and backward.

Q: Are mobility scooters covered by insurance coverage?A: Some insurance coverage, consisting of Medicare, might cover the cost of a mobility scooter under specific conditions. It's crucial to examine with your insurance coverage service provider to comprehend what is covered and any needed documents.

Q: Can I drive a mobility scooter on the pathway?A: In numerous places, mobility scooters are permitted on pathways and in pedestrian locations. However, local policies may differ, so it's best to talk to your regional authorities.

Q: How fast do mobility scooters go?A: The speed of mobility scooters near me scooters varies depending upon the model. The majority of scooters have a maximum speed of 4 to 8 miles per hour, with some high-performance designs reaching up to 10 miles per hour.

Q: Can I take a mobility scooter on public transport?A: Many public transport systems, consisting of buses and trains, have provisions for buy mobility scooter scooters. Nevertheless, it's recommended to inspect the specific rules and requirements of your local transit authority.

Q: How do I maintain my mobility scooter?A: Regular maintenance is essential for the durability and security of your mobility scooter. This includes checking the battery, tires, and brakes, and following the manufacturer's upkeep schedule. It's also a great idea to keep the scooter clean and store it in a dry location.
